D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a flame stabilizing device for stabilizing a main flame in a gas burner.

Generally, gas burners have a main flame hole formed by opening a large number of small holes, and the opening of the main flame hole is small, so that the mixture (gas ejected from the nozzle and primary air sucked in by the jet stream) is mixed. Since the ejection speed of the main flame increases, lifting of the main flame at the main flame hole is likely to occur, and flame stabilization is provided to prevent this.

A conventional example of a gas burner having such flame holding property is shown in FIG.

In the figure, 1 is a burner chamber, 2 is a decompression chamber, 3 is a throttle hole, 4 is a main flame hole, 5 is a flame holding hole, 6 is a top portion having the main flame hole 4, and 7 is a gas passage.

The air-fuel mixture is first introduced into the burner chamber 1 and is ejected from the main flame hole 4 to form a main flame, and a portion of the mixture is sufficiently depressurized through the throttle hole 3 in the decompression chamber 2, and then ejected from the flame holding hole 5. to form a flame-holding state.

However, since such a gas burner involves drawing of the gas passage 7, etc., it is difficult to maintain processing accuracy, and variations in flame hole opening area, top bending state, etc. occur, and a satisfactory flame cannot be formed.

A part of the air-fuel mixture is ejected from the zero-restriction passage hole 3 through the depressurization chamber 2 and from the flame holding hole 5, but because it passes through a complicated path, uniform ejection cannot be obtained, resulting in variations in flame holding. A stable flame cannot be formed throughout.

If the 0-diaphragm through-hole 3 is drilled before the drawing process, the dimensional change due to the drawing process will be large, making it impossible to obtain a predetermined opening area and making it impossible to regulate the amount of flame-holding ejection.

Furthermore, if holes are made after drawing, the workability of the holes will be poor.

Therefore, the present invention aims to provide a stable flame stabilizing device that eliminates these drawbacks and is inexpensive to process.

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described based on FIGS. 1 to 7. Reference numeral 8 denotes a burner body, which is made by bending a flat plate having a large number of small holes. , a bottom portion in which a burner chamber 11 is formed.

A large number of throttle holes 12 are provided at lower positions on both sides of each main flame hole 9 of the top part 10 where the main flame holes 9 are formed, and a collision plate 13 located opposite to these throttle holes 12 is inserted into the side wall of the burner body 8. It sticks to the part.

The collision plate 13 may be one in which collision portions 13a and notched ventilation portions 13b are arranged alternately as shown in FIG. 6, or one in which collision portions 13 are continuously provided as in FIG. 7! A type 13' having a small ventilation hole 13'b is used.

Furthermore, a notch 14 for receiving the burner head is provided on the lower surface of the center of the burner body 8, and as shown in FIG. Ru.

Incidentally, the burner head 15 is integrally connected to a mixing pipe (not shown), and is supplied with an air-fuel mixture.

Next, to explain the operation, the gas ejected by the nozzle and the primary air sucked in by it are thoroughly mixed in the mixing tube, and then introduced into the burner head 15 and distributed to the burner chambers 11 of each burner body 8. , each burner body 8
As the air-fuel mixture flows from the burner chamber 11 to the top 10, the flow speed increases, and it is ejected from each main flame hole 9, and forms a flame 17 with the help of the flame holding 16 that ejects from the throttle hole 12 and burns.

In order to prevent the flame 17 from lifting from the main flame hole 9, the flame holding 16 blows out a mixture of about 20% of the main flame from the burner chamber 11 through a large number of restricting holes 12, and uses the blowing force to prevent the flame 17 from lifting. Collision part 13a [or 13a of collision plate 13] while taking in ambient air from ventilation part 13b [or ventilation hole 13b']
'), the jet velocity is rapidly weakened, and the mixture is sufficiently diffused and mixed to perform stable combustion between the top part 9 and the collision plate 13.

With this stable flame holding 16, a stable flame 20 can be obtained as described above.

As described in detail above, the present invention consists of a burner body made by bending a flat plate with a large number of small holes arranged thereon, and comprising a top part with a main flame hole and a bottom part with a burner chamber. A large number of throttle holes are formed on both sides of the lower part of the top part, and a collision plate having an air-fuel mixture collision part and a ventilation part is fixed to the side wall of the burner body at a position opposite to the throttle holes. , it is less likely to cause processing variations in the main flame hole like in the past, and the jet flow velocity is reduced on both sides of the main flame hole, allowing diffusion and mixing with the surrounding air to form a stable flame holding of equal volume. Therefore, since a good combustion state can be maintained, it has become possible to provide a flame stabilizing device that forms a stable flame with a simple structure and at low cost.
